We’re ZSL, an international conservation charity. Our vision is a world where wildlife thrives and we’re working every day to achieve this. From investigating the health threats facing animals, to helping people and wildlife live alongside each other, we are committed to bringing wildlife back from the brink of extinction. Through the work of our pioneering scientists, our dedicated conservationists and our unrivalled animal experts in our two zoos, our purpose is to inspire, inform and empower people to stop wild animals going extinct.

Role Profile

ZSL is looking for an Institutional Fundraising Manager who will lead on securing sustainable large-scale (6/7+ figure grants) restricted funding from international statutory, bi-lateral and multi-lateral agencies. The successful candidate will be responsible for operationalising the Institutional Fundraising team strategy, taking responsibility for driving income from international statutory, bi-lateral and multi-lateral funding programmes. The postholder will also manage a small portfolio of international trusts and foundations and undertake prospect research of all international grant-making opportunities.

Main Duties and Responsibilities

  • Working with the Fundraising Senior Management Team to maintain and cultivate strategic donor relationships with overseas government agencies, bi-lateral and multi-lateral agencies, to identify large-scale funding opportunities
  • Produce well researched and evidenced bids, leading and directing the relevant teams across ZSL and ensuring the highest submission standards.
  • Lead the end-to-end management and ownership throughout the entirety of the technical bid lifecycle.
  • Lead the review of proposal submissions against donor requirements, for quality and accuracy.
  • Develop a creative approach to the writing and presentation of technical bids.
  • Lead project teams to ensure all reporting requirements are fulfilled to the highest standards and ensure that appropriate reporting schedules are implemented.
  • Manage the internal review of donor contracts /agreements and associated Terms and Conditions to ensure ZSL compliance.

Person Specification

  • Strong track record in fundraising for science and conservation projects commensurate with ZSL’s work.
  • Experience of the programme design process including the development of log-frames.
  • Strong track record of securing international statutory funding relevant to ZSL’s core objectives.
  • Excellent written and spoken English.
  • Strong organisational, interpersonal and presentation skills.
  • Comfortable with reading and analysing scientific research and translating complex ideas into well-presented, persuasive proposals.
  • Sound understanding of global biodiversity conservation issues.
  • Demonstrable strategic, scientific and analytical mind-set.
  • Excellent time management and organisational skills.
